FEATURED SPEAKER
Kevin Mulcahy, an Oakland County resident, works as an Assistant U.S. Attorney in Detroit, and serves as the Executive Assistant United States Attorney.
Kevin will recount his own story of sexual exploitation at the hands of his soccer coach, Randy. But it will not be merely a retelling of the past.
Instead, he will address what was learned from his case by combining his experience both as a victim and as a longtime federal prosecutor of child exploitation cases.
Kevin's personal history as an abuse survivor, his recollection of his own case's investigator (great), prosecutor (terrible) and forensic interview (Kevin did not have one), and his experience and expertise provide a unique insight into how we can improve the lives of child victims of abuse.
